Mercedes-Benz GLK-Class: Theft deterrent locking systems

Immobilizer

The immobilizer prevents your vehicle from being started without the correct SmartKey.

When leaving the vehicle, always take the SmartKey with you and lock the vehicle. The engine can be started by anyone with a valid SmartKey that is left inside the vehicle.

  • To activate with the SmartKey: remove the SmartKey from the ignition lock.
  • To activate with KEYLESS-GO: switch the ignition off and open the driver's door.
  • To deactivate: switch on the ignition.

In the event that the engine cannot be started when the starter battery is fully charged, the immobilizer may be faulty. Contact an authorized Mercedes-Benz Center or call 1-800-FOR-MERCedes (in USA) or 1-800-387-0100 (in Canada).

ATA (Anti-Theft Alarm system)

A visual and audible alarm is triggered if the alarm system is armed and you open:

  • a door
  • the vehicle with the mechanical key
  • the tailgate
  • the hood

The alarm is not switched off, even if you close the open door that has triggered it, for example.

(USA only) or TELE AID (Canada only) initiates a call to the Customer Assistance If the alarm stays on for more than 30 seconds, the emergency call system mbrace (USA only) or TELE AID (Canada only) initiates a call to the Customer Assistance Center automatically. The emergency call system initiates the call provided that:

  • you have subscribed to the mbrace/ TELE AID service.
  • the mbrace/TELE AID service has been activated properly.
  • the required mobile phone, power supply and GPS are available.

  • To arm: lock the vehicle with the SmartKey or KEYLESS-GO. Indicator lamp 1 flashes. The alarm system is armed after approximately 15 seconds.
  • To deactivate: unlock the vehicle with the SmartKey or KEYLESS-GO.
  • To stop the alarm using the SmartKey: insert the SmartKey into the ignition lock. The alarm is switched off.

  • To stop the alarm using KEYLESS-GO:
    grasp the outside door handle. The SmartKey must be outside the vehicle. The alarm is switched off.

or

  • Press the Start/Stop button on the dashboard. The SmartKey must be inside the vehicle.
    The alarm is switched off.
